Price Comparison
The Horizon Fitness 5.0R Recumbent Bike is priced at $649.99, while the Sunny Health & Fitness Elliptical Recumbent Cardio Bike comes in at $449.99, making it about 31% cheaper. This significant price difference may be a deciding factor for budget-conscious buyers. The Horizon bike, although more expensive, boasts advanced features like Bluetooth connectivity and a larger weight capacity of 350 pounds. In contrast, the Sunny Health & Fitness model, while less costly, offers a solid range of features that cater to those looking for an effective home workout without breaking the bank.
Design and Build Quality
The design of the Horizon Fitness 5.0R Recumbent Bike emphasizes comfort and accessibility, featuring a step-through frame for easy entry. Its extra-large seat is equipped with lumbar support, ensuring a comfortable riding experience. On the other hand, the Sunny Health & Fitness model is designed with low impact in mind, promoting joint health during workouts. While both bikes have user-friendly designs, the build quality of the Horizon bike appears slightly more robust, given its higher weight capacity and premium materials.
Workout Experience
With the Horizon Fitness 5.0R, users can expect a high-performance workout, supported by a 15.4 lb aluminum flywheel that allows for a smooth and quiet ride. It also provides the ability to adjust resistance levels up to 100, catering to various fitness levels. Meanwhile, the Sunny Health & Fitness Elliptical Bike features 8 levels of magnetic resistance, which, while fewer than Horizon’s, still offers enough variety for a comprehensive workout. The dual handlebars on the Sunny bike allow for a full-body workout, engaging multiple muscle groups effectively.
Technology and Connectivity
The Horizon Fitness 5.0R stands out with its Bluetooth connectivity, enabling users to connect with fitness apps and track performance metrics, including resistance, cadence, and heart rate. This connectivity enhances the overall workout experience, making it more interactive. Conversely, the Sunny Health & Fitness model also offers app integration through the SunnyFit app, which provides access to over 1,000 trainer-led workouts and allows users to track their progress without any additional membership fees. While both bikes offer technological advantages, the Horizon’s Bluetooth capability may appeal more to tech-savvy users.
Comfort and Ergonomics
Comfort is a key feature of both bikes, but they approach it differently. The Horizon Fitness 5.0R emphasizes a plush, adjustable seat that glides along an aluminum rail, providing an ergonomic fit for long rides. In contrast, the Sunny Health & Fitness bike features an extra-wide cushioned seat and non-slip handlebars, ensuring security and comfort during workouts. Both models prioritize user comfort, but the Horizon bike's focus on an adjustable seat may make it more suitable for longer sessions.
Storage and Portability
When it comes to storage and portability, the Horizon Fitness 5.0R is designed for easy movement with transport handles and wheels for relocation. It measures 66" x 25.2" x 52.2", which may require more space compared to the Sunny Health & Fitness model, which is more compact at 63" x 48" x 28.9". The Sunny bike is also equipped with transportation wheels, making it easier to store when not in use. Therefore, if space is a concern, the Sunny model may be the better choice for users needing a more compact option.
